Understanding the Basics of Case Battles
Before diving into advanced methods, one need to understand <strong>CS2 Case Battles</strong> http://www.bbc.co.uk/search?q=CS2 Case Battles how Case Battles work. Multiple players (typically 2 to 4) buy into a lobby by selecting the exact same set of cases. Simultaneously, the cases are opened, and the total worth of the dropped skins for each gamer is determined.
Winner Takes All: The gamer with the greatest total skin value at the end of the battle wins all the items dropped in the match.Modes: Variations exist, such as "Group Battles" (2v2), "Terminal" (where the lowest value wins), and "Crazy Mode" (where the gamer with the least expensive overall value takes whatever).
Because these modes alter the characteristics of danger and benefit, players can not count on a single approach.

Credible case field of honor utilize Provably Fair systems, which depend on cryptographic algorithms to make sure that the result of every case opening is entirely random and can not be controlled by the platform or other gamers. Nevertheless, like any casino-style video game, the home constantly has a mathematical edge over the long term.

Are these websites legal?
The legality of third-party CS: GO gaming and case opening sites varies considerably depending upon your nation of home. Constantly inspect local laws and policies regarding online digital possession betting before taking part.
